About this release

Bred by @the_farma NYB originates from Nigerian regional genetics, while Growlersburg comes from Afghan × Hindu Kush (Pure Kush) lineage. This is genuinely one of the most impressive plants I’ve ever run. She survived my absolutely over-the-top stress-testing gauntlet and came out as the lone female champion—and wow, did she earn that spot. She’s ridiculously resilient, basically unfazed by grower slipups. Give her food and a passable environment and she takes off with thick stems, huge leaves, and an aggressive root system. Everything about her feels powerful, like strength is her whole personality. Even under tough conditions, she outperformed five other plants and still stacked up big, chunky flowers. She shrugs off drought, tolerates a bit of overwatering, and while she can push back against PM, she might show a couple small spots if another plant nearby is acting as a host. NYB × 49 loads every branch with dense, bract-heavy buds from top to bottom. In veg she carries that classic, unmistakable old-school dank gas—the kind of smell that instantly makes you say, “Yeah, I’ll take that.” In bloom she settles into a smoother, kush-forward aroma. After curing, she becomes this incredibly creamy kush with soft notes of coffee and earth. The smoke is unbelievably smooth—almost like actual cream. While the flavor leans kushy, the effect feels distinctly Afghan: clear in the mind, deeply relaxed in the body. It’s like getting wrapped in a blanket with a great book—calm, warm, and very present. She’s proven herself again and again and will definitely stay in rotation for future breeding work. Her expressions are so uniquely strong that it truly feels like something rare and special worth carrying forward in the gene pool
